Formula

m3/h = imp fl oz/s × 0.102287

imp fl oz/s = m3/h ÷ 0.102287

Frequently asked questions

What is the source unit in this conversion?

The source unit is imperial fluid ounces per second (imp fl oz/s). The Imperial Fluid Ounce (imp fl oz) is a unit of volume. The Second (s) is a unit of time.

What is the destination unit in this conversion?

The destination unit is cubic meters per hour (m3/h). The Cubic Meter (m3) is a unit of volume. The Hour (h) is a unit of time.

How do I convert imperial fluid ounces per second to cubic meters per hour?

Multiply the imperial fluid ounces per second value by 0.102287 to get cubic meters per hour. For example, 10 imp fl oz/s × 0.102287 = 1.02287 m3/h.

Is the imperial fluid ounces per second to cubic meters per hour conversion exact?

It's exact under the SI-based volume and time definitions used here, since both units convert to cubic meters per second through fixed, non-rounded factors.

Where is this conversion commonly used?

Flow rate conversions like this are used in plumbing, HVAC, irrigation, chemical processing, fuel and water metering, and engineering flow calculations.

Can I convert cubic meters per hour back to imperial fluid ounces per second?

Yes. Divide the cubic meters per hour value by 0.102287 (or multiply by 9.77641) to get imperial fluid ounces per second.

About this conversion

This page converts imperial fluid ounces per second (imp fl oz/s) into cubic meters per hour (m3/h), two units of volumetric flow rate.

The Imperial Fluid Ounce (imp fl oz) is a unit of volume. The Second (s) is a unit of time.

The Cubic Meter (m3) is a unit of volume. The Hour (h) is a unit of time.

The formula is m3/h = imp fl oz/s × 0.102287, based on the fixed relationship between these two flow rate units.

Flow rate is calculated as a volume unit divided by a time unit, so every combination of a volume unit and a time unit forms a valid, exact flow rate unit.
